Сообщение от krutoy
|
bes,
Тебе надо не спеки читать, а литературу по основам программирования.
|
ерунду не говори, спецификация eсmascript - строгий документ, в котором используются, в частности, контекстно-свободные грамматики, это означает, что любой нетерминал можно свести к последовательности терминалов, так как именно их совокупность передаётся на вход транслятору
http://es5.javascript.ru/x5.html#x5.1.1
Цитата:
|
Начиная с предложения, состоящего из одиночного помеченного нетерминала – начального символа, данная КС грамматика определяет язык, а именно – ряд (возможно, бесконечный) допустимых последовательностей терминальных символов, которые могут получиться в результате неоднократной замены какого-либо нетерминала в этой последовательности на символы, указанные в правой стороне правила, для которого этот нетерминал является левой частью.
|
если нет строгого определения, должно быть произвольное описание
если в данном случае это забыли сделать, то будет понятно
Сообщение от Aetae
|
Если утрировать: то что можно записать в одну строку без точки с запятой.)
|
а что можно записать в одну строку без точки с запятой?
именно это и определяется в спецификации: что можно, а что нельзя